A Brief History of Japanese Pornography
The Early Beginnings
The origins of adult-themed art in Japan can be traced back to the Edo period (1603-1868), where shunga (erotic woodblock prints) were popular among various classes. These artworks were not merely sexually explicit; they were celebrated for their artistic merit and were often imbued with humor, love stories, and social commentary. As Dr. Takashi Morita, an art historian, states, “Shunga represents a unique blend of eroticism and artistry, reflecting the complexities of human relationships and societal norms of its time.”

The Role of Censorship
Censorship is a critical aspect of Japanese pornography. Under Japanese law, all genitalia in adult films must be blurred, creating a more surreal viewing experience. While many see this as a limitation, it has inadvertently led to innovative artistic representations in adult content—a unique aspect that differentiates Japanese pornography from that of other nations.
